| /** |
| * This class manages the set of transitions that fire when there is a |
| * change of {@link Scene}. To use the manager, add scenes along with |
| * transition objects with calls to {@link #setTransition(Scene, Transition)} |
| * or {@link #setTransition(Scene, Scene, Transition)}. Setting specific |
| * transitions for scene changes is not required; by default, a Scene change |
| * will use {@link AutoTransition} to do something reasonable for most |
| * situations. Specifying other transitions for particular scene changes is |
| * only necessary if the application wants different transition behavior |
| * in these situations. |
| * |
| * <p>TransitionManagers can be declared in XML resource files inside the |
| * <code>res/transition</code> directory. TransitionManager resources consist of |
| * the <code>transitionManager</code>tag name, containing one or more |
| * <code>transition</code> tags, each of which describe the relationship of |
| * that transition to the from/to scene information in that tag. |
| * For example, here is a resource file that declares several scene |
| * transitions:</p> |
| * |
| * {@sample development/samples/ApiDemos/res/transition/transitions_mgr.xml TransitionManager} |
| * |
| * <p>For each of the <code>fromScene</code> and <code>toScene</code> attributes, |
| * there is a reference to a standard XML layout file. This is equivalent to |
| * creating a scene from a layout in code by calling |
| * {@link Scene#getSceneForLayout(ViewGroup, int, Context)}. For the |
| * <code>transition</code> attribute, there is a reference to a resource |
| * file in the <code>res/transition</code> directory which describes that |
| * transition.</p> |
| * |
| * Information on XML resource descriptions for transitions can be found for |
| * {@link android.R.styleable#Transition}, {@link android.R.styleable#TransitionSet}, |
| * {@link android.R.styleable#TransitionTarget}, {@link android.R.styleable#Fade}, |
| * and {@link android.R.styleable#TransitionManager}. |
| */ |

| /** |
| * Convenience method to animate to a new scene defined by all changes within |
| * the given scene root between calling this method and the next rendering frame. |
| * Calling this method causes TransitionManager to capture current values in the |
| * scene root and then post a request to run a transition on the next frame. |
| * At that time, the new values in the scene root will be captured and changes |
| * will be animated. There is no need to create a Scene; it is implied by |
| * changes which take place between calling this method and the next frame when |
| * the transition begins. |
| * |
| * <p>Calling this method several times before the next frame (for example, if |
| * unrelated code also wants to make dynamic changes and run a transition on |
| * the same scene root), only the first call will trigger capturing values |
| * and exiting the current scene. Subsequent calls to the method with the |
| * same scene root during the same frame will be ignored.</p> |
| * |
| * <p>Passing in <code>null</code> for the transition parameter will |
| * cause the TransitionManager to use its default transition.</p> |
| * |
| * @param sceneRoot The root of the View hierarchy to run the transition on. |
| * @param transition The transition to use for this change. A |
| * value of null causes the TransitionManager to use the default transition. |
| */ |
